Choosing the Right AI Aggregator: Critical Selection Criteria for Businesses

Picking the right AI aggregator can be a game-changer for your business in 2025. Start by focusing on what really matters: scalability, integration, cost, support, and security. These five pillars ensure the platform grows with you and fits seamlessly into your existing operations. Additionally, businesses must consider the influence of dominant platforms, whose market power and data strategies can shape the competitive and legal environment when evaluating AI aggregators.

Five Key Steps to Spot Your Perfect AI Aggregator

  • Assess scalability and performance requirements

Can the aggregator handle your expected data volumes and workloads? Look for platforms proven to scale smoothly, whether you’re a startup or enterprise, and ensure they maintain high data accuracy even as data volumes grow.

  • Evaluate integration capabilities with existing systems

Compatibility matters: your CRM, ERP, marketing tools, and databases should connect effortlessly to avoid siloed data and duplication.

  • Consider total cost of ownership

Beyond subscription fees, factor in implementation costs, training time, and ongoing maintenance. Sometimes cheaper upfront means expensive down the line.

  • Review vendor support and partnership approach

Check the provider’s willingness to collaborate and customize. You want a partner that offers proactive support, not just a helpdesk.

  • Verify security, privacy measures, and compliance certifications

With data privacy regulations ramping up globally—think GDPR in Europe, CCPA in California—robust encryption, access controls, and audit capabilities aren’t optional.

Ensuring Robust Security and Compliance in AI Aggregation

As AI aggregators pull in vast amounts of data, data security becomes a top priority. Expanding data flows invite risks—anything from breaches to unauthorized access—that businesses cannot afford.

Multi-Layered Security Frameworks: Your New Best Friend

Implementing a multi-layered security approach is essential. This typically includes:

  • Encryption at rest and in transit, which locks down data everywhere
  • Access controls and identity management ensuring only authorized users gain entry
  • Data anonymization techniques to protect sensitive info when possible
  • Continuous monitoring and threat detection to catch issues early

These layers work together like a well-trained squad, defending your AI ecosystem from potential threats.

Navigating the Compliance Jungle

Regulations like GDPR, CCPA, and HIPAA keep tightening their grip, especially for businesses operating across borders. Compliance isn’t just legal box-ticking—it’s about building systems that handle data responsibly and transparently.

Key steps to stay compliant include:

  • Mapping data flows to understand where info lives and moves
  • Regular audits and documentation to prove adherence
  • Collaboration with legal and IT to keep up with regulation updates

Businesses embracing these practices build trust and avoid costly fines that can quickly eat into budgets.
